Answer:

x=2, y=-5/2

Step-by-step explanation:

to find the 'x' intercept, set the 'y' value to zero and solve:

5x - 4(0) = 10

5x = 10

x = 2

to find the 'y' intercept, set the 'x' value to zero and solve:

x(0) - 4y = 10

-4y = 10

y = -10/4 or -5/2
